#679c56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#679c56 is composed of 40.4% red, 61.2%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 105.4 degrees, a saturation of 28.9% and a lightness of 47.5%. #679c56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ffac with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#679c56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030402 is the darkest color, while #f8faf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#679c56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#758072 is the less saturated color, while #3cf002 is the most saturated one.
